EN AC-21100 Aluminum vs. Titanium 15-3-3-3

EN AC-21100 aluminum belongs to the aluminum alloys classification, while titanium 15-3-3-3 belongs to the titanium alloys. There are 28 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(3,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is EN AC-21100 aluminum and the bottom bar is titanium 15-3-3-3.
